Fontaines D.C. have announced a second concert at Slane Castle next summer due to demand.

The Dublin band will now play the Co Meath venue on Sunday 27 June 2027, the day after their previously announced show on Saturday 26 June.

Hayley Williams, Damien Dempsey and Madra Salach will also perform, with more acts still to be announced.

Announcing the additional date on Wednesday morning, Fontaines D.C. said tickets for the new show would be available through the pre-sale from 10am on Wednesday, with the general sale beginning at 10am on Thursday.
